Title:   Amphora with Graffito
Category:   Pottery
Description:   One handle missing. Piriform body; very low neck; thickened rim; handles rising from neck. Wall deeply furrowed.
Scratched on shoulder: <graphic>
Gritty red clay, light buff surface, worn.
Context:   Well at S.E. corner of court of Late Roman Building.
